Transaction 70c5392c7811b7c6d3fcaf76763cea9f795777685d1f9bcac5b04c5987673894

2 Input
2 Outputs
  • 70c5392c7811b7c6d3fcaf76763cea9f795777685d1f9bcac5b04c5987673894:0
  • value  12629
    address  19UfJRxCTrD4qfxpyxqBBKmzdx9L6gUP9y
  • 70c5392c7811b7c6d3fcaf76763cea9f795777685d1f9bcac5b04c5987673894:1
  • value  1035630
    address  1PEgLapG39Tw6w3AY8SHUYbZWYxuUjbC5T